Output ea5dd50b37ca41cc232c35431da09bbd6b3a8554881e0237ea7df088ce0d0ad9:0

value
309589391
script pubkey
OP_0 OP_PUSHBYTES_20 cdc44c36e2916eeee539311cb132cb9b3eab00b1
address
ltc1qehzycdhzj9hwaefexywtzvktnvl2kq93dmlyzw
transaction
ea5dd50b37ca41cc232c35431da09bbd6b3a8554881e0237ea7df088ce0d0ad9
spent
true